Re: Mando Clan Name
So, I did some reading on Wookieepedia, and it seems that while some of the leaders of clans used their name for the clan name (Fett, Ordo, etc.) it seems not everyone in the clan followed suit.
And, there was much written on the Mando'a language, so I started looking through vocabulary lists for some insight.
I was putting together phrases like "kot be olan" meaning "strength of a hundred", but while these phrases communicate that "small clan that's tougher than their size would indicate" feel I was going for, they don't seem to don't seem to fit with the names that were presented as sample names.
So, I suggest that we call ourselves Clan Olan, roughly translating to "the Hundred". It gives it a militaristic feel, and is implies without really explaining a cohesive, threatening group. And, in cryptic Mandalorian fashion, we certainly don't have to explain it to those we conquer when they ask - that is until they join us.
